Miles and Roy Mustang sat in a sterile hospital room, friends surrounding them and keeping them company. Miles had a lanky arm wrapped around his husband's shoulders, the black-haired man nestled into his side. It seemed smaller than usual, not used to the intense feeling of vulnerability. But no matter what, he would not shy away from the touch of his husband, who held the matching wedding band, no matter how many people had their eyes on them.

Miles was almost certain they both still had blood on them from the final battle on the Promised Day. Father had been ruthless in order to get what he desired the most: Truth. He wanted to itch all of his skin at the thought that Riza Hawkeye's blood was still caked on him, staining his hands, as he held her dying body in his arms.

He still remembered the indescribable emotion that surged through his nerves as he watched his husband disappear before him, and as his best friend began to breathe laboriously with her slit neck. The thought of loosing them both in that moment drove him to the edge, and he recalled with a physical cringe how he had screamed and sobbed over Riza's body, his tears washing the blood off of his ring.

'Not... going... anywhere,' the strained words from the angelic woman's mouth had quickly brought him back, her hand gripping his arm tightly. 'Have to make sure... Roy treats you...good.'

It gave him the strength he needed to get up, to fight, to find his husband. It gave him the strength he needed to not break in front of the man who needed him most, when seeing how lost the man seemed. It gave him the strength he needed to support Roy when seeing his stumbling form, and his clouded eyes.

Yeah, the Promised Day was fucking insane. (By far the most insane part was seeing Alphonse in his actual body. Sure, basically a walking skeleton, but still his body. Now he could actually see the kid he had grown to adore smile.)

But his thoughts fled from him as the sound of a newcomer came through. Roy perked up, but had come to learn that he shouldn't waste his energy turning to look. Miles did that for him, adjusting his glasses as he glanced to the door with curiosity.

"Sorry for interrupting," the social worker apologized, noticing how quickly everyone in the room had fallen silent. "I just had some news about Kishore."

Roy's back straightened at her words, and everyone else stared at her intently. Miles didn't notice the way he was turning his ring in nervousness.

"It's been confirmed that his parents survived the Ishvalan Civil War. They broke off from the rest of the refugees though, and joined a small group that decided to flee to Xing. They didn't make it far into the desert before dying of dehydration and malnutrition. It's a miracle that Kishore survived, being only a year old and all. If that shepherd hadn't found him..." She stopped glancing away sadly. She had seen many cases like this, as it was her job, but they all had some different personal effect. "Anyways, he's looking for someone to adopt him, if you two are still interested."

Roy smiled. He had surprisingly been the one to find out about the Ishvalan orphan, convincing Miles that this boy was meant to be their son. Miles had made sure Roy knew how insensitive to his birth parents that was, but after setting his eyes on the child couldn't help but feel a sudden longing to hold him.

It was a big step, and a quick one at that. But as Roy Mustang himself had said, "I'd be blind for several lifetimes if it meant raising this boy with you."

"Kishore Mustang..." Miles hummed. Their friend looked at the two of them. They all already knew the answer. The social worker was the only one waiting. "Almost sounds as good as Miles Mustang."

And Roy laughed.
